#556d56 - RGB(85, 109, 86) - Finlandia Color FAQ

What is the color code for Finlandia?

Hex color code for Finlandia color is #556d56. RGB color code for finlandia color is rgb(85, 109, 86).

What is the RGB value of #556d56?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#556d56 is rgb(85, 109, 86).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'85' indicates the intensity of the red component, '109' represents the green component's intensity, and '86'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#556d56.

What does RGB 85,109,86 mean?

The RGB color 85, 109, 86 represents a dull and muted shade of Green. The websafe version of this color is hex 666666.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Finlandia.

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#556d56?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#556d56 is composed of 22% Cyan, 0% Magenta, 21% Yellow, and 57% Black.
